Design Ideas for Black and Red Bedroom Walls
Monochromatic Magic
For a bold and cohesive look, consider a monochromatic scheme with varying shades of black and red. This approach creates a rich, luxurious, and cocooning effect. To prevent the space from feeling overwhelming, incorporate plenty of natural light and use mirrors to reflect light around the room.
- Paint the walls a deep, dark red and pair with black bedding, curtains, and furniture.
- Alternatively, paint the walls a deep, inky black and use red accents for bedding, throw pillows, and area rugs.
Accent Walls and Balance
If a full monochromatic scheme feels too intense, consider using an accent wall to create a focal point. This approach allows you to incorporate both colors while maintaining a balance in the room. Here are a few ideas:
- Paint one wall a deep, dramatic red and the other walls a soft, dark grey or black. Balance the red with black bedding, furniture, and accessories.
- Create a feature wall using black wallpaper or a black painted brick effect. Pair with red bedding, curtains, and decorative accents.
Neutralize with White
To soften the impact of black and red bedroom walls, incorporate plenty of white. White creates a clean, crisp contrast that prevents the room from feeling too heavy or oppressive. Consider the following:

- Paint the walls a deep, dark red and pair with white bedding, furniture, and accessories.
- Paint the walls a soft, dark grey or black and use white for bedding, curtains, and decorative accents. Add pops of red through throw pillows, artwork, and area rugs.
Creating Balance and Harmony
To ensure your black and red bedroom walls feel inviting and harmonious, consider the following tips:
- Balance the scale: Ensure there's a balance between the two colors to prevent the room from feeling too heavy or overwhelming. This can be achieved through the use of accent walls, neutral colors, or varying shades of black and red.
- Incorporate texture and pattern: Add texture and pattern through bedding, throw pillows, area rugs, and wall art to create visual interest and break up the bold color scheme.
- Lighting is key: Use layered lighting to create a warm, inviting atmosphere. Incorporate floor lamps, table lamps, and wall sconces to soften the harshness of overhead lighting.
